It’s a personal question of course but we have a ' purpose in asking it and you will gain by answering it £ S LISTEN---HERE'S THE DOPE The “Herald” is a necessity in every home. You simply can’t get along without it. Of course there's a time when even a newspaper is not thought of. We are going to think of it for you. Se Yok v “Herald” Starting now every couple married in New Britain, or expecting to live here after the honeymoon, will be presented with a three months’ subscription to the real New Britain paper free. WE WANT TO START YOU RIGHT. After the three months are up you will be given an opportunity to subscribe—NOT BEFORE. So send to the Herald office your future home address, to which you wish the paper delivered, together with the date of your start at housekeeping and get the news every evening.
